The current age of Robert is 91. Robert has listed (563) 391-2890 as his phone number. Robert was born in 1932. Robert is a resident of 6714 Birchwood Ave #B, Davenport, Ia 52806. Public records show Davenport as a city Robert also stayed in.
Public records show that Robert is German. He belongs to Western European ethnic group. He doesn't have problems speaking English. According to public records Robert's education level is high school. Robert was born on 1932-07-14.